Current Reality Podcast Live: Gendered Virtue in Children
In this episode of the Current Reality Podcast, hosts Michael Clary and Wade Thomas delve into the topic of gendered virtue in parenting, a theme stemming from the King's Domain Conference they are attending. They share personal convictions about raising boys to embrace masculinity and girls to embrace femininity, grounded in their Christian faith. The discussion critiques gender-neutral parenting and the transgender movement, with references to cultural and news sources that promote these perspectives. They argue that these ideologies represent a departure from biblical teaching and natural law. Hosts emphasize the importance of scripture in guiding parenting and living, aiming to provide a counter-narrative to the prevailing culture through biblical truths and the joy of raising children in accordance with God-given gender roles.

Why the World Economic Forum Wants Depopulation
In this episode of the Current Reality Podcast, Michael and Wade address the deadly and dehumanizing issue of population control, critiquing the Darwinian idea that the Earth is overpopulated, championed by Paul Ehrlich, Planned Parenthood, and the World Economic Forum. They argue against viewing humans merely as consumers, advocating instead for the biblical view of humans as creators and stewards of Earth, made in God's image. The discussion extends to questioning modern societal trends of prioritizing personal luxury over building households, drawing on teachings from Augustine and Jerome. This episode aims to reshape the listener's understanding of the value of children and the importance of procreation within marriage. It underlines the intrinsic value of human life and the sanctity of family as central to Christian belief, encouraging a departure from the societal norm of willful childlessness among married couples for personal gratification.
